Identifying Faulty RAM and Resolving Issues
In this section, we will guide you through the process of troubleshooting and fixing faulty RAM issues. If you experience frequent crashes, random system reboots, or the dreaded blue screen of death, the problem may be caused by faulty RAM. Follow our step-by-step solutions to identify and resolve these computer hardware problems.
1. Check for Physical Damage
The first step in identifying faulty RAM is to check for any physical damage. Inspect the memory modules for any signs of wear or damage, such as cracks or broken pins. If the RAM appears to be in good condition, move on to the next step.
2. Run a Memory Diagnostic Test
Running a memory diagnostic test is an effective way to identify faulty RAM. Windows 10 has a built-in memory diagnostic tool that can be accessed by following these steps:
- Click on the Start menu and search for “Windows Memory Diagnostic.”
- Select “Restart now and check for problems.”
- Wait for the diagnostic test to complete and view the results.
If the test indicates that there are issues with your RAM, move on to the next step.
3. Reseat the RAM
Reseating the RAM is a simple solution that can fix many computer hardware problems. Follow these steps:
- Turn off your computer and unplug it from the power source.
- Open your computer’s case and locate the RAM modules.
- Take out the modules and reinsert them firmly into their sockets.
- Close the case, plug in your computer, and turn it on.
If this does not fix the problem, move on to the next step.
4. Replace the RAM
If the above steps do not resolve the issue, it may be time to replace the faulty RAM. Purchase a new RAM module that is compatible with your computer’s motherboard and replace the old one. Be sure to follow the manufacturer’s instructions for installation.

Identifying Hard Drive Failures
Before we dive into the solutions, it’s crucial to know the signs of hard drive failure. One of the most common symptoms is the occurrence of strange noises that include clicking, grinding, or whirring sounds. Other indicators include error messages when booting your computer or files that cannot be accessed.
Once you identify any of these signs, you need to act quickly. Firstly, backup all your data to an external hard drive or cloud storage. This ensures that you will not lose any essential files in the event that the hard drive fails completely.
Strategies for Data Recovery
If you have already experienced a hard drive failure, don’t panic. There are solutions that can help you recover your data. The first step is to determine whether your hard drive has logical or mechanical damage.
If it is logical damage, the hard drive may not be physically damaged, and the data can be recovered using data recovery software. However, if there is mechanical damage, you will need to send it to a data recovery service provider to recover your data.
Hardware Problem Solutions
If you have determined that your hard drive has physical damage, here are some hardware problem solutions to try:
| Hardware Problem | Solution |
|---|---|
| Head crash | Replace the read/write heads and restore the data |
| Motor failure | Replace the motor and restore the data |
| Platter damage | Replace the platters in a cleanroom environment and restore the data |
Note that these solutions require specialised knowledge, and should only be attempted by qualified professionals.

Troubleshooting Graphics Card Problems
When it comes to common computer faults and hardware problems, issues with graphics cards are quite frequent. They can cause various display problems and significantly affect your computer’s performance. But don’t worry, understanding these problems and troubleshooting them isn’t as complicated as it seems.
Firstly, you must be familiar with the signs of graphics card problems. These include visual artifacts like flickering, freezing, or distorted graphics, as well as errors such as the blue screen of death.
If you’re experiencing issues with your graphics card, here are some practical solutions:
Update Your Graphics Card Drivers
If you notice any problems with your graphics card, the first thing you should do is check if your drivers are up to date. Outdated drivers can cause a series of problems, including poor performance and visual errors. You can update your drivers manually or use software like Driver Booster to help you with the task.
Clean Your Graphics Card
If you’ve been using your computer for a while, dust and debris may have accumulated on your graphics card, causing overheating and other problems. Cleaning your graphics card can make a significant difference. To clean it properly, turn off your computer, unplug it from the power source, and remove the graphics card. Use a can of compressed air to blow away the dust and debris, then reinsert the graphics card and power on your computer.
Check Your Graphics Card’s Connections
If your graphics card isn’t seated properly or the connections are loose, it can cause issues with your computer’s display. Open your computer case and ensure that the graphics card is securely seated into the PCI-E slot. Also, make sure that all the cables are connected firmly.
Replace Your Graphics Card
If none of the above solutions work, it might be time to replace your graphics card. Look for a graphics card that’s compatible with your computer and meets your performance needs. Don’t forget to properly uninstall your old drivers before installing the new hardware.

Fixing Overheating Issues and Maintaining Optimal Cooling
Overheating is a common computer hardware fault that can cause serious damage to your system. In this section, we will explore how to identify overheating problems and provide effective solutions for maintaining optimal cooling.
How to Identify Overheating Issues
There are several signs of overheating that you can look out for, including:
- Your computer fan running louder than usual
- Your computer shutting down unexpectedly
- Your computer freezing or slowing down
- Your computer’s surface feeling unusually warm
If you notice any of these signs, it’s important to take action right away to prevent further damage to your system.
Effective Solutions for Maintaining Optimal Cooling
Here are some simple and effective solutions for maintaining optimal cooling and preventing overheating:
| Solution | Description |
|---|---|
| Clean your computer’s fans and vents | Dust and debris can accumulate in your computer’s fans and vents, reducing airflow and causing overheating. Regularly clean your computer to remove any buildup. |
| Invest in a cooling pad | A cooling pad is a simple and affordable solution that can help keep your computer cool. These pads are designed to improve airflow and reduce heat buildup in your system. |
| Avoid using your computer on soft surfaces | Soft surfaces like bedding, couches, and carpets can block your computer’s vents and reduce airflow, causing overheating. Always use your computer on a hard, flat surface to promote optimal cooling. |
| Adjust your power settings | High-performance power settings can cause your computer to generate more heat. Switch to a balanced or power saver setting to reduce heat buildup and optimize cooling. |
| Upgrade your cooling system | If you’re experiencing chronic overheating issues, it may be time to upgrade your cooling system. Consult with a professional to determine the best solution for your system. |

Resolving Connectivity Problems and Network Issues
In today’s interconnected world, network connectivity is critical. Unfortunately, computer hardware faults can cause connectivity problems that can hinder your productivity. In this section, we will discuss the most common hardware problems that cause connectivity issues and provide effective solutions to help you restore your network connection.
Identifying Connectivity Issues
One of the first steps in resolving connectivity issues is identifying the problem. Here are some common hardware faults that can cause network connectivity problems:
- Network card failure
- Loose or disconnected network cables
- Incompatible or outdated network drivers
- Wireless connection interference
- Router or modem malfunction
Once you’ve identified the issue, you can begin troubleshooting to resolve the problem.
Resolving Connectivity Problems
If you’re experiencing connectivity issues, try the following solutions:
- Check hardware connections: Ensure that all network cables are properly connected and that your network card is working correctly.
- Update network drivers: Make sure you have the latest network drivers installed for your computer.
- Check for wireless signal interference: If you’re using a wireless connection, check for signal interference from other devices and move closer to your router if possible.
- Restart your router or modem: Try restarting your router or modem to refresh the connection.
- Reset network settings: If all else fails, resetting your network settings to default can often solve connectivity issues.
When to Seek Professional Help
If you’re still experiencing connectivity issues after trying the above solutions, it may be time to seek professional help. A hardware technician can diagnose and resolve complex hardware problems that may be causing network issues.

What are the most common computer hardware faults?
The most common computer hardware faults include faulty RAM, hard drive failures, graphics card problems, overheating, and connectivity issues.
How do I identify faulty RAM?
To identify faulty RAM, you can run a memory diagnostic tool or perform a physical inspection of the RAM modules. Additionally, you can try swapping out the RAM modules with known good ones to see if the issues persist.
How can I resolve issues related to faulty RAM?
To resolve faulty RAM issues, you can try reseating the RAM modules, cleaning the contacts, updating the motherboard’s BIOS, or replacing the faulty RAM modules.
What should I do in case of a hard drive failure?
In case of a hard drive failure, it is important to stop using the drive immediately to prevent further damage. You can try data recovery software or consult a professional data recovery service for assistance.
How do I troubleshoot graphics card problems?
To troubleshoot graphics card problems, you can start by updating the graphics card drivers, checking the connections and cables, and testing the graphics card in another computer. If the issues persist, you may need to replace the graphics card.
What can I do to prevent overheating issues?
To prevent overheating issues, make sure your computer is well-ventilated and clean from dust. You can also check the fan speeds and apply thermal paste on the CPU if necessary. Using cooling pads or investing in additional fans can also help maintain optimal cooling.
How do I resolve connectivity problems and network issues?
To resolve connectivity problems and network issues, you can start by checking the network cables and connections, resetting the modem or router, updating the network drivers, and running network diagnostics tools. You can also contact your internet service provider for further assistance.
